Add to basketOriginal vintage travel poster published by British West Indies Airways (BWIA) to advertise Trinidad and Tobago featuring a bright and colourful image of a limbo dancer wearing a red and white striped top, next to a palm tree with a plane flying overhead, performing this national dance of Trinidad and Tobago with stylised text above and below the image in white letters on a dark blue background. Artwork by the Italian artist and illustrator Aldo Cosomati (1895-1977). Established in 1939, BWIA was a subsidiary of BOAC until 1961 and the leading airline company in the Caribbean based in Trinidad until 2006, when it was replaced by Caribbean Airlines. Silkscreen. Good condition, restored creases and repaired minor tears, backed on linen. Size: 76x50.5cm.
